Why Impact Garage Doors Make a Difference for Your Property

Securing your property begins at every opening, and impact garage doors stand as the most critical investments a resident can make. Unlike standard garage doors, impact garage doors are built to withstand hurricane-force winds, storm-driven objects, and severe pressure fluctuations that build up during severe weather events.

For property owners living in South Florida, that's hardly a hypothetical concern. Atlantic hurricanes affect the region annually, and a failed garage door is among the most common weak spots for catastrophic loss. What This Category Involve

Impact garage doors are a dedicated class of products of heavy-duty doors tested and rated to meet Miami-Dade approval standards. In simple terms, these doors are constructed from reinforced steel with internal bracing systems that prevent bowing, buckling, or total failure when pressure forces peak.

The category encompasses much more than simply swapping out a door. A thorough impact garage door installation generally covers selecting the right door style, evaluating the header and framing, upgrading all mechanical components, and finishing a final code inspection. The Tangible Benefits of Properly Installed Impact Garage Doors

Investing in impact garage doors means more than passing an inspection. The advantages include property owners gain from a properly specified and installed impact garage door:

  • Hurricane and Wind Resistance — Certified against category-four equivalent wind pressure, ensuring the garage structurally sound during extreme tropical weather.
  • Flying Object Resistance — Heavy-gauge door skins resist and stop impact from two-by-four lumber fired at high velocity, meeting standard TAS-201 test requirements.
  • Premium Reductions Through Certified Upgrades — Many Florida insurers offer measurable savings to properties featuring impact-rated garage doors, sometimes covering a share of the total project price.
  • Improved Energy Efficiency and Insulation — Foam-core impact door panels block outdoor temperatures through the garage, cutting monthly energy bills in South Florida's intense summer heat.
  • Enhanced Home Security — Heavier construction ensure impact garage doors significantly harder to force open compared to conventional garage doors.
  • Increased Property and Resale Value — Storm-rated door replacements are documented improvements that attract buyers in hurricane-aware markets and appear favorably on real estate disclosures.
  • Quieter Operation and Exterior Sound Blocking — Dense construction materials limit outside noise transmission penetrating the garage, providing additional quiet year-round.
  • Resistance to Salt Air and Humidity Corrosion — Coatings and hardware on quality impact garage doors are selected to resist the combined effects of ocean air and South Florida's climate.

Frequently Asked Questions About Impact Garage Doors

What is the average price range for impact garage doors?

Cost for impact garage doors depends on several factors based on door size, material, insulation level, and wind pressure rating. A standard single-car residential door with standard insulation and solid panels typically falls in the $2,000 to $3,200 bracket installed. Wider double-bay installations, custom designs, or doors with decorative glass can exceed $6,000 for high-end configurations. You will receive a detailed, itemized quote following your consultation.

How are impact garage doors different from standard hurricane-rated garage doors?

There is an important technical difference worth understanding. Standard hurricane-rated doors are engineered to resist sustained wind forces but are not necessarily certified for the full HVHZ certification standard. True impact garage doors must pass the combined structural and projectile resistance evaluations, making them the required choice in coastal South Florida building jurisdictions.

How many days does it take to complete an impact garage door project?

On-site installation work for a typical residential project usually takes a single business day. Keep in mind, the complete job duration from start to sign-off typically takes three to six weeks depending on how quickly the building department processes the permit and schedules the final inspection.

Is a building permit required for impact garage door installation in Florida?

In most cases, yes. Florida building code requires a permit for any garage door replacement, impact garage doors and impact garage doors are no exception. Unpermitted installations can create problems at resale and may create liability if the door fails during a storm. What ongoing care does an impact garage door need?

Maintenance requirements are minimal compared to the protection they provide. We recommend lubricating the springs, rollers, and copyrights every six to twelve months, rinsing the exterior surface after major storms to clear any residue, and arranging an annual service call on a regular basis to verify that all components are performing correctly.
